FIFA in talks about requiring soccer clubs to field at least one homegrown young player in games

VANCOUVER (BRITISH COLUMBIA): (Apr 29) FIFA has opened talks about requiring all professional teams to field at least one homegrown young player throughout games.

The FIFA Council agreed late Tuesday to try to have a formal plan within a year after global consultation with stakeholders.

The target is to increase playing opportunities for young players nurtured by clubs who typically rely on bought and imported talent.
